28 About Your System
E1712 PCI SERR B##
D## F##
The system BIOS has
reported a PCI system error
on a component that resides
in PCI configuration space
at bus ##, device ##,
function ##.
Remove and reseat the
PCIe expansion cards. If
the problem persists, see
"Troubleshooting
Expansion Cards" on
page 149.
PCI SERR Slot
#
The system BIOS has
reported a PCI system error
on a component that resides
in the specified slot.
Remove and reseat the
PCIe expansion cards. If
the problem persists, see
"Troubleshooting
Expansion Cards" on
page 149.
E1714 Unknown Err The system BIOS has
determined that there has
been an error in the system,
but is unable to determine
its origin.
See "Getting Help" on
page 167.
E171F PCIE Fatal
Err B## D##
F##
The system BIOS has
reported a PCIe fatal error
on a component that resides
in PCIe configuration space
at bus ##, device ##,
function ##.
Remove and reseat the
PCIe expansion cards. If
the problem persists, see
"Troubleshooting
Expansion Cards" on
page 149.
PCIE Fatal
Err Slot #
The system BIOS has
reported a PCIe fatal error
on a component that resides
in the specified slot.
Remove and reseat the
PCIe expansion cards. If
the problem persists, see
"Troubleshooting
Expansion Cards" on
page 149.
E1810 HDD ## Fault The SAS subsystem has
determined that hard drive
## has experienced a fault.
See "Troubleshooting a
Hard Drive" on page 144.
